找回密码
 立即注册
搜索

西门子PLC这9个常见的运用成绩,你知道如何处理吗


由于PLC占全球PLC市场的一半,因此有必要对它有一个片面的了解。

首先,让我们看一下这9个常见的运用成绩。你知道如何处理吗?

1.为什么运用计时器加自复位功能反复调用其他功能或子例程的计时时,它似乎无法正常工作?

请留意《 S7-200 PLC系统手册》中三个计时器刷新规则的描画。

当以这种方式运用计时器时,计时器的放置和重置能够与程序的扫描周期不婚配,并且存在导致上述成绩的机制。定时工夫较短的定时义务应运用“定时中缀”功能,这种功能愈加牢靠。

2.运用计时器的程序已被编译并在编译时传递。为什么下载到CPU时提示错误?

这种状况通常是由于呼叫计时器号码和计时器类型不兼容惹起的。请参阅协助表,例如,T7只能用作TONR,不能用作TON或TOF。

3,定时中缀(SMB34 / SMB35)是最长的定时器255ms,如何完成更长的定时?

可以运用T32 / T96中缀,最长工夫为32.767s。在工夫中缀服务程序中,计算中缀次数也可以延伸中缀工夫。

4.假如中缀次数不够,怎样办?

每个定时中缀服务程序不一定只处理一个定时义务。它可以将多个义务放在一个定时中缀服务程序中。

对于具有不同定工夫隔的义务,可以将其定时长度的最大公约数计算为定时中缀的工夫设置。中缀事情在中缀服务程序中计数,并且相应地由程序处理不同的义务。

5.运用子例程时,为什么只能执行一次操作,或者某些形状不能结束?

假如无法反复执行某个动作,或者形状无法结束(好像已被锁定),并且这些功能与该子例程有关,请检查能否存在调用该子例程的条件。在执行上述动作之后,或者当它们进入某种形状时,调用子例程的条件不再有效,它们不能再次被“激活”。脱离上述形状或复位的指令仅在子例程中,这将不可避免地导致上述现象。

6.当多次调用带有方式参数的子程序时,为什么OUT类型的变量会互相关扰?

这是由于定义为OUT类型的方式参数参与了子例程外部的操作。任何此类参数都应定义为IN_OUT类型。

7.为什么与中缀服务程序有关的计算义务偶然会产生不正确的结果?

出现这种现象的缘由是在主(子)程序和中缀程序之间传输数据的机制不正确。

中缀程序可以随时执行,假如此时主程序(或子程序)正在运用中缀程序运用的数据,则中缀结果能够会带入中缀程序,从而导致计算结果发生变化;异样,中缀程序中生成的数据对主程序(子程序)中的计算也有相似的影响。

8.中缀服务程序似乎还没有执行?

您可以将测试段添加到中缀程序中,例如运用SM0.0(通常为“ 1”)放置输入点(运用Set指令)以观察能否进入中缀服务程序。中缀程序不执行,次要是由于初始化(衔接中缀事情和中缀程序)成绩,或者没有“打开中缀”。 SM0.1(或沿触发器)运用于执行初始化然后中缀。

9.衔接TP170,TP170 micro和S7-200时如何停止“时钟同步”?

TP170的默许时钟格式不同于S7-200 PLC PLC时钟指令读取的工夫和日期格式。为了使时钟与TP170同步,需求更改时钟读取。 TP170的组态软件ProTool的在线协助中对其停止了引见。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复

使用道具 举报

大神点评8

回复

使用道具 举报

千鹤 2019-10-15 15:04:35 显示全部楼层
分享了
回复

使用道具 举报

艾鱨 2019-10-15 15:11:14 显示全部楼层
分享了
回复

使用道具 举报

分享了
回复

使用道具 举报

1259288165是我 2019-10-15 15:25:17 显示全部楼层
分享了
回复

使用道具 举报

宇智波八夜 2019-10-16 13:48:03 来自手机 显示全部楼层
LZ是天才,坚定完毕
回复

使用道具 举报

龙生皇 2019-10-17 14:01:34 来自手机 显示全部楼层
秀起来~
回复

使用道具 举报

樱木迷 2019-10-18 13:22:42 显示全部楼层
有点兴趣,要有详细介绍就好啦。
回复

使用道具 举报

高级模式
B Color Image Link Quote Code Smilies